This position is responsible to oversee the planning, implementation, and tracking of specific project which have a beginning, an end and specified deliverables. The incumbent works closely with upper management to make sure that the scope and direction of each project is on schedule. Coordinates internal resources and vendors to ensure that all projects are delivered on-time, within scope and within budget.

Responsibilities

  • Develops project scopes and objectives involving all relevant stakeholders and ensures technical feasibility.
  • Creates a detailed work plan which identifies and sequences the activities needed to successfully complete the project.
  • Determines the resources required to complete the project
  • Develops a schedule for project completion that effectively allocates resources to the activities required.
  • Determines objectives and measures to evaluate the project at its completion.
  • Executes the project according to the project plan.
  • Monitors the progress of the project and make adjustments as necessary.
  • Ensures the project deliverables are on time, within budget and meet quality expectations.

Knowledge / Skills / Abilities

  • Demonstrated knowledge of project management.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ects at once.
  • Ability to analyze and document complex business processes.
  • Ability to prepare written and verbal communications for projects.
  • Demonstrated human relations and effective communication skills.
